Abstract
A new type of silica optical micro-kayak cavity fabricated on a silicon chip is designed
and demonstrated. This micro-kayak cavity with two straight sides and two semi-circle sides can be
used to achieve a compact and flexible arrangement in the design of integrated photonic circuits.
The micro-kayak cavity can also be embedded with a Bragg reflection grating in the straight sides
for frequency selection using a micro-kayak cavity laser doped with a rare-earth ion. We describe
the fabrication methods for the micro-kayak cavity, obtain its spectra, and discuss its potential
applications.
